Web3 apr. 2024 · Project Manager. Project manager duties: Develop a project plan. Manage deliverables according to the plan. Recruit project staff. Lead and manage the project team. Determine the methodology used on the project. Establish a project schedule and determine each phase. Assign tasks to project team members. Generation Climate Europe (GCE) is the largest coalition of youth-led networks on climate and environmental issues at the European level. GCE unites the largest youth-led networks, bringing together 381 national organisations across 46 countries in Europe. Web19 jan. 2024 · Identify project scope: Lay out the project’s tasks, goals, and objectives so that work boundaries are clear right at the beginning. Identify project deliverables: Define what project deliverables you need to deliver to ensure your project is a success. Identify project stakeholders: Identify the stakeholders that will be involved in the project.
